Micro Niche Finder Review
Since I have been using Micro Niche Finder for my keyword research for nearly a year now, I thought I should write a review about my experiences with this product. While keyword research tools are not 100% accurate, Micro Niche Finder is just about as good as they get.
You can look at the keywords in some different ways to get a pretty good picture of how to focus your writing, approaches, and market research. I find this invaluable at every level, in part because Micro Niche Finder is so easy to use. I can look at an overview of a search very quickly, get rid of the high competition and low volume searches almost immediately, and go directly to those keyword phrases that are most valuable.
Only after I’ve finished the initial keyword research do I drill down into the “Measure of backlinks” and “Strength of Competition” areas. Sometimes I don’t even go that far. for instance, if I’m just doing a post, I may just get an overview and move on. It’s so simple to use that I can have basic keyword research on almost everything I put on my blogs and websites.
If tried other programs, and most are OK, but there are 2 things that Micro Niche Finder does better than the other keyword tools. One, you can do a search and have the data in minutes. It ‘s fast and easy. You don’t get bogged down with the tool. Second, it save your searches to a database that is very easily accessed.

When you run a search, it saves your keyword research to a database automatically and seamlessly. That’s a real plus because you can come back later when you are tweaking a site and quickly fine tune your earlier work.
I’ve used Market Samurai, and it is an excellent choice. In fact, I sometimes use the free version to double check my work. I just find Micro Niche Finder more intuitive. I can get the work done in half the time. That makes a real difference.
